FACP Relay Operation
The following description of FACP relay operations are in addition to normal system operation.
Alarm Relay - activation of Input Zone 1 (2-Wire Smoke) or Zone 2 (Fire) or Zone 3 (Water-
flow - with Waterflow Delay time) or Zone 4 (Manual Release) or Zone 5 (Pull Station) will
operate Alarm Relay
Trouble Relay - any system trouble will activate the Trouble Relay
Supervisory - activation of Zone 6 (Supervisory) will operate the Supervisory Relay

Notes:
1.
Waterflow Delay is programmed for 10 seconds.
2.
All End-of-Line Resistors, illustrated in this example, are 4.7KΩ, ˝ watt (PN: 71252).
3.
All devices are connected as Class B circuits. For details on connecting as Class A circuits,
refer to "CAC-5X Class A Converter Module" on page 29.
